Guiding primary school students to carry out extra-cursory reading can start from the following aspects: 1. Stimulate interest: Reading is a voluntary activity. Primary school students are often interested in reading. Therefore, they can stimulate their interest in reading by telling interesting stories and displaying excellent literary works. 2. Choose books suitable for reading: The reading level of primary school students is uneven, so they need to choose books suitable for them. They could choose some easy-to-understand and interesting books such as fairy tales, comics, picture books, etc. to help them adapt to reading faster. 3. Set up a reading plan: Primary school students need to have a certain degree of planning for their reading. You can make a weekly or monthly reading plan so that they can clearly read books and read time. 4. To encourage communication and sharing: Reading is not only a personal matter, but also allows primary school students to share their reading experiences with others. They could be encouraged to share their reading experiences with their classmates or participate in activities such as reading clubs. 5. Focus on guiding thinking: Extra-cursory reading is not only a passive acceptance of knowledge, but also requires primary school students to think and explore. In the process of reading, they could be guided to think about the plot of the story, the fate of the characters, the author's writing style, etc. to help them better understand the content. The cultivation of primary school students 'reading ability requires long-term accumulation and guidance. It needs to gradually establish good reading habits and reading ability from many aspects.
